source: spip-zone/_plugins_/acces_restreint/trunk/formulaires/editer_zone.html @ 88251

Last change on this file since 88251 was 88251, checked in by rastapopoulos@…, 6 years ago

Ajout d'un hidden avec id_zone dans l'édition comme pour les autres contenus (les articles par ex) sinon il n'est pas possible d'ajouter des erreurs. Par défaut il n'y a pas d'erreur possible et donc le hit ne s'arrête jamais à verifier() mais si on veut en ajouter…

File size: 2.5 KB
Line 
1<div class="formulaire_spip formulaire_editer formulaire_editer_zone formulaire_editer_zone-#ENV{id_zone,nouveau}">
2        [<p class="reponse_formulaire reponse_formulaire_ok">(#ENV**{message_ok})</p>]
3        [<p class="reponse_formulaire reponse_formulaire_erreur">(#ENV**{message_erreur})</p>]
4        [(#ENV{editable})
5        <form method='post' action='#ENV{action}' enctype='multipart/form-data'><div>
6                [(#REM) declarer les hidden qui declencheront le service du formulaire
7                parametre : url d'action ]
8                #ACTION_FORMULAIRE{#ENV{action}}
9          <input type="hidden" name="id_zone" value="#ENV{id_zone}" />
10          <ul>
11            <li class="editer editer_titre obligatoire[ (#ENV**{erreurs}|table_valeur{titre}|oui)erreur]">
12                <label for="titre"><:accesrestreint:titre_zones_acces:></label>[
13                                <span class='erreur_message'>(#ENV**{erreurs}|table_valeur{titre})</span>
14                                ]<input type='text' class='text' name='titre' id='titre' value="#ENV{titre}" />
15            </li>
16            [(#ENV{id_zone}|intval|non|et{#AUTORISER{modifier,zone}})
17            <li class='editer editer_droit_admin'>
18                <div class='choix'><input type='checkbox' name='droits_admin' value='oui' id='droits_admin' checked="checked" />
19                <label for='droits_admin'><:accesrestreint:ajouter_droits_auteur:></label></div>
20            </li>]
21            <li class='editer editer_publique_privee'>
22                <div class='choix'><input type='checkbox' name='publique' value='oui' id='publique'[ (#PUBLIQUE|=={oui}|oui)checked="checked"] />
23                <label for='publique'><:accesrestreint:zone_restreinte_publique:></label></div>
24                <div class='choix'><input type='checkbox' name='privee' value='oui' id='privee'[ (#PRIVEE|=={oui}|oui)checked="checked"] />
25                <label for='privee'><:accesrestreint:zone_restreinte_espace_prive:></label></div>
26            </li>
27            <li class="editer editer_descriptif[ (#ENV**{erreurs}|table_valeur{descriptif}|oui)erreur]">
28                        <label for="descriptif"><:accesrestreint:descriptif:></label>[
29                        <span class='erreur_message'>(#ENV**{erreurs}|table_valeur{descriptif})</span>
30                        ]<textarea name='descriptif' rows='5' id='descriptif'>[(#ENV{descriptif})]</textarea>
31            </li>
32                  <li class='editer editer_rubriques fieldset'><fieldset><legend><:accesrestreint:rubriques_zones_acces:></legend>
33                  [(#INCLURE{fond=formulaires/inc-select_rubriques}{rubriques=#ENV{rubriques}})]</fieldset>
34                  </li>
35          </ul>
36          [(#REM) ajouter les saisies supplementaires : extra et autre, a cet endroit ]
37          <!--extra-->
38          <p class='boutons'><input type='submit' class='submit' value='[(#ENV{id_zone}|?{<:bouton_enregistrer:>,<:bouton_ajouter:>})]' /></p>
39        </div></form>
40        ]
41</div>
Note: See TracBrowser for help on using the repository browser.